How Industry Experience Shapes Your Career
One of the most crucial aspects of building a successful career is having industry experience. It’s important to have experience working in your chosen field to increase your chances of getting hired and excelling in your chosen profession.
Industry experience means that you have gained expertise in a particular field through work experience, training or education. It encompasses a variety of skills and knowledge related to a specific industry.
When you have industry experience, you are more familiar with industry jargon, trends, and best practices. You know how the industry works, how the market behaves, and what’s necessary to succeed in the business. It also means that you understand the culture and etiquette within that industry.
Industry experience can be a valuable asset when applying for a job, especially if you have worked in the industry for many years. Employers are more likely to choose candidates who have proven themselves in the industry over those who are new to it.
Industry experience can open up doors for higher-level positions and better pay. It demonstrates your capabilities and commitment to your chosen profession.
Having industry experience can give you a competitive edge in the job market. It shows that you are committed, knowledgeable, and capable of excelling in your industry.
